# Onboarding: EXIF scrubbing in Pixwash

All uploads pass through Pixwash before storage. It strips GPS, device, and timestamp EXIF tags. Never bypass it, even for internal test images. If the scrub worker queue backs up, scale the strip-pool, don't disable validation. Config lives in the pixwash-core repo; changes need two approvals. If the scrub keystore locks during a restart, recover it with the passphrase below.

vault phrase of kawep-tahog = ulaix-briath

Quick note for the security review of Pinefold's canary gating. We hold each canary at 5% traffic until error-rate and latency checks pass, then step up automatically; any auth-related alert hard-blocks promotion regardless of other signals. Capacity-wise, the duplicate canary pods add about 8% headroom cost during rollouts. The gating thresholds currently enforced are listed below.

tuning table, yajog-yahof:
BUDGETS = {
    "lamvan": 303,
    "wenox": 460,
    "fenvan": 525,
}

### Step 3: Switch to the new locker access flow

In this step you migrate SudsPoint's laundry-locker access from the legacy PIN handshake to the token-based flow. New team members: note that tokens are minted per locker bank, not per user, so the old per-user grants must be revoked first. Run the revocation script, verify the audit log shows zero active PINs, then apply the following configuration:

config for yajep-tafof:
[rusath]
team = julmir
access_code = ac_fe37fd
host = rusath.novactech.test
port = 8000
owner = pelmir.weneth
peer = oliwyn.olvarqdyn.internal

Ticket: Staging env misconfigured for Siftgate bloom filter

The bloom layer in front of the Pellet KV store is rejecting all lookups in staging because the env file was copied from the dev template without credentials. False-positive tuning values are fine; only the auth line is missing. To unblock the weekly demo, the Pellet admission secret must be set on the following line.

env line for yaguf-fajop: LEDGER_TOKEN13=fb08984397349